Scientists have found evidence of water vapor on the alien planet HAT-11b, 124 light-years from Earth. The Neptune-size exoplanet is the smallest known with water in its atmosphere.
Neptune-Size Alien Planet Shows Signs of Water Vapor. A Neptune-size planet beyond the solar system has traces of water vapor in its atmosphere, making it the smallest "wet" exoplanet yet to be found.
